This is an MIUI build for the Sony Xperia T. It was ported from a combination of the MIUI.us build for the HTC One S and the MIUIAndroid build for the Galaxy Nexus. The base ROM used was my latest ParanoidAndroid build.

What is MIUI?
MIUI is a heavily themed ROM (which IMHO looks beautiful) based on JellyBean. For more info see http://miuiandroid.com

Working:
All core and important functions of the ROM - WiFi, Bluetooth, RIL, Mobile Data. Camera etc.​

Not working:
There will inevitably be some bugs. I've played with it for a few days and I couldn't fin anything glaringly broken in my usage. However, I fully expect there to be minor problems here and there - please feel free to report on this thread.​

Some more bugs although probably related:-

Unable to download from web
Unable to download languages for Swiftkey keyboard

Still running fairly smoothly although H/W buttons keep blacking out and reshuffling.
Same issue (downloads) in some other ROM's. Try fix permissions in CWM first, if that doesn't work, backup your internal SD and then format it and copy back over what you need. That should fix it.
